Obituary for Marlene S. (White) McKenna
Anthon, Iowa - Marlene S. (White) McKenna, of Barling, Arkansas, and formerly of Anthon, Iowa went to be with the Lord on March 3, 2014. The Funeral Mass will be held Saturday, March 8, 2014, at 10:30 a.m. at St. Mary's Catholic Church in Oto, Iowa, at 10:30 a.m. with Rev. Dan Greving officiating. Burial will be in St. Mary's Catholic Cemetery at Oto. Visitation will be one hour prior to the Mass at the church. Armstrong Funeral Home of Anthon is in charge of the arrangements. The family is receiving condolences on line at www.armstrongfuneral.com Marlene S. (White) McKenna was born August 5, 1952 in Sioux City, Iowa, the daughter of Harold and Joan F. (Fitzpatrick) White. She was a graduate of Anthon-Oto High School and was united in marriage to Cecil McKenna. The couple were blessed with four children and have made their home in Barling, Arkansas. Marlene was a former employee of Simmons Foods for 15 years in the QA Dept. and Carmen Trucking for 11 years before having to leave for her illness.ξ She has left behind her husband Cecil McKenna of 40 years, 3 daughters Tammy Cain and husbandξ Freddy of California, Michelle Robine and husband Joseph of Greenwood, AR., Cheryl McKenna of Barling and a son Michael McKenna and his wife Vanessa of Van Buren, 2 sisters Coleen McKenna and husband Bill of Garrettson, South Dakota and Patricia Deeds and husband Dan of Correctionville, Iowa and her beautiful grandchildren whom she adored, Briana Robine, Zachery McKenna, Dakota Watson, Kaitlyn Robine, Ashton McKenna and Mabrey and Ava McKenna; along with several friends and her amazing cancer support group, the Reynolds Cancer Support. She was preceded in death by her parents Harold "Moe" and Joan White, and 2 brothers Paul and John White. ξ
